Prince Louis, born on April 23, 2018, is fourth in line to the British throne. Since his early years, his charismatic personality has stood out among the royal family members. During public appearances, he has become known for his candid expressions, including amusing reactions during Queen Elizabeth II’s Platinum Jubilee and his lively energy at official celebrations.

the king’s health struggles and royal duties
In February 2024, Buckingham Palace announced that King Charles III had been diagnosed with prostate cancer, a revelation that sparked public concern and adjustments to his royal schedule. Known for maintaining a busy agenda, the king had to scale back on engagements and restructure his commitments based on medical recommendations. The decision to disclose his health condition was a historic moment, as the British monarchy has traditionally kept personal matters private.
The diagnosis required Charles to follow a treatment and recovery plan, directly impacting his role as head of state. Nevertheless, he remained present at key events, including the Easter Sunday service in Windsor, which marked an important moment of resilience and strength.

memorable moments between king Charles III and Louis
King Charles III’s coronation in May 2023 was a defining moment that displayed the strong connection between the monarch and his grandchildren. During the historic event, Prince Louis and his sister, Princess Charlotte, captured public attention with their affectionate interactions with their grandfather. The young prince’s candid expressions and occasional moments of distraction brought a touch of authenticity to the grand occasion.
Another significant moment occurred during Christmas 2024, when the royal family gathered at Sandringham for their annual celebrations. Louis made headlines for breaking a long-standing royal tradition by wearing long trousers instead of shorts, which has been customary for young boys in the royal family. This subtle change signified a more modern and flexible approach within the monarchy, reflecting the evolving dynamics of the royal household.
